The AutoCAD 35 Under 35 Young Designers List
Did you know that this year (2017) marks the 35th anniversary of AutoCAD? Developed and marketed by AutoDesk, AutoCAD was initially release in December 1982 as a desktop app running on microcomputers with internal graphics controllers (from Wikipedia).
